Soul-Warming Barley Chicken & Vegetable Soup - Flipped-Out Food The poor performance was originally believed to be because of barleys high fiber content, but hull-less barley cultivars show similar performance levels to that of the hulled cultivars. Commercial phytase, a feed enzyme that can be added to poultry diets to improve the availability of phytate-bound phosphorus, is also available. Secondly, and more ideally, offer nutritious sprouted grains during the winter months. Older birds are more able to utilize barley than young chicks. Instead of the seeds holding tight to their protective barriers, soaking them in liquid suggests that it's time to release all those inhibiting enzymes and phytates, such that the nutritive content of some foodsgrains, seeds, legumes, and nutsbecome available to those eating them.
